Active Listening Techniques

Active listening forms the foundation of effective communication and boosts confidence during conversations. I focus on these techniques to enhance my listening skills:

  • Paraphrasing: I repeat what the speaker said in my own words to show understanding.

  • Asking Questions: I engage with clarifying questions to encourage deeper dialogue.

  • Body Language Awareness: I maintain eye contact and nod to show attentiveness.

Practicing active listening helps me respond thoughtfully, fostering a more meaningful exchange. When I focus on the speaker, it creates a comfortable environment that encourages openness and honesty.

Non-Verbal Communication Skills

Non-verbal communication plays a crucial role in how messages are perceived and my confidence levels during conversations. I pay attention to several non-verbal cues that can significantly impact interactions:

  • Posture: I maintain an open and relaxed posture to convey confidence.

  • Facial Expressions: I use appropriate expressions that match my spoken words to reinforce my message.

  • Gestures: I incorporate gestures to emphasize key points and enhance engagement.

By mastering non-verbal skills, I enhance my ability to connect with others and ensure that my messages resonate clearly. Subtle cues can convey more than words alone, making my communication more effective and authentic.

Practice and Preparation

Preparation is critical for confident speaking. I practice my delivery to refine my communication skills. Here are effective strategies I use for preparation:

  • Rehearsing: I practice my speeches or conversations in front of a mirror or with a friend to build comfort.

  • Outlining: I create outlines of key points to maintain focus during discussions.

  • Simulating Scenarios: I role-play different conversational situations to prepare for unexpected questions.

Preparation not only boosts my confidence but also familiarizes me with the topic. When I feel ready, I can participate in conversations more naturally and with assurance.

Building Confidence Through Experience

Experience plays a vital role in enhancing my speaking confidence. The more conversations I engage in, the more comfortable I become. I take these steps to build confidence:

  • Gradual Exposure: I start with smaller, less intimidating conversations and work my way up to larger groups.

  • Seeking Constructive Feedback: I ask trusted friends or colleagues for feedback on my speaking skills to identify areas for improvement.

  • Acknowledging Progress: I recognize and celebrate my progress, no matter how small, to maintain motivation.

Building confidence is an ongoing process. Through regular practice and reflective experiences, I can develop my speaking abilities and engage more effectively in conversations.

Overcoming Fear of Public Speaking

Fears often stem from worries about judgment or failure. I tackle this fear by recognizing it as a common experience. To combat anxiety, I practice thorough preparation. Familiarizing myself with the topic and my audience allows me to speak more confidently.

  • Visualization techniques: Before a conversation, I visualize myself successfully communicating. This mental rehearsal reduces anxiety by creating a sense of familiarity with the situation.

Engaging in small group discussions gradually builds my comfort level. Each positive interaction reinforces my skills and self-belief. Ultimately, embracing mistakes as learning opportunities fosters a more positive approach to public speaking.
